I was a really angry person in 2012 and 2013, listening to fans with Eeyore voices go, "Oh nooo... we need a QB and there just aren't any good prospects available. That's just our luck." Yeah, you can fall ass over tea kettle into Tom Brady or Russell Wilson. That can happen. You can get lucky and suck at just the right time so that the perfect QB you need is sitting right there staring at you waiting for you to hand him a Chiefs hat and a #1 jersey and snap the ****ing photo with Goodell. Or you can do what the Packers did and take matters into your own hands. Your QB's getting long in the tooth? Trying to squeeze the last few years out of your franchise guy? Then plan a****inghead and start drafting QBs. Take one every year in the late rounds. Try to find a midrounder that intrigues you. Pull the trigger IMMEDIATELY the very instant you come across a high-profile prospect you think could be your next guy. If we approach this situation like we did the end of Trent Green's career and just sit and fart around until Smith retires or can't play anymore, we're going to be "forced" to trade for another backup. Lucky for us that Reid has a history of being proactive with the QBs his team drafts. That and Dorsey's record of personnel-building lends me to believe that they ARE indeed planning ahead into the future at the QB position. |
